Equipping Hygiene and Health. In the critical realm of public health and wellness, our surfactants are the very first line of protection versus illness. They are the active components in the soaps and sanitizers that remove infections and microorganisms, breaking down the lipid envelopes of microorganisms and rendering them safe. Beyond health, they play a crucial function in the pharmaceutical industry, acting as emulsifiers and solubilizers that allow powerful medicines to be provided successfully within the body. We are happy to be a component of the global health and wellness framework, guaranteeing that tidiness and medication come to all.
Changing Market and Farming. In the severe atmosphere of hefty industry, our surfactants are the distinction between a clogged pipeline and a moving stream. They are made use of in oil healing to mobilize trapped petroleum, in metalworking to cool down and oil reducing tools, and in fabrics to ensure dyes pass through fibers evenly. In agriculture, they function as adjuvants, assisting pesticides and herbicides spread uniformly throughout plant leaves, reducing the amount of chemical required and decreasing environmental runoff.
